Troubleshooting: Game doesn't start / Crashes on start
Some intro text first, for those who care:

First of all, if you're experiencing an issue like this, I'm sorry to hear that (I really do - I've spent a lot of time customizing and modernizing the engine, so prestigious club of hardcode RPG players could enjoy the game). Still, in the world of PCs and its countless hardware/software/drivers combinations, something can always go wrong. If it happened for you - worry not, we'll figure it out. Maybe it will take some time and your input, but we will.

So, if you have troubles starting up the game, it means there is most likely a conflict between your OS and the game engine, as the gameplay code hasn't been reached yet, so it's not a thing we could break for you because we're lame or something =) Needless to say, it's still something we're most interested to fix for you. So, let's go through the troubleshooting steps.

TL;DR - Troubleshooting Steps

1) Please update your DirectX, downloading the file from here:
https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=8109

I know you may have done it recently, I know Steam installed something automatically, I know that a hundred of other games did it before for you. Still, DirectX is a large collection of libraries, and if installed from a different package, a couple of files may be missing. So better spend an extra minute and try that.

2) Update C++ runtime libraries:
https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=30679
https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=48145

Pick a x86 version for each (vcredist_x86.exe).

We've configured Steam to do this for you, but maybe you have a different version installed and Steam didn't recognize it properly? Who knows. It's a small file, just download and install it. It won't hurt, and may be useful to have for some other applications too.

3) Update your videocard drivers

It just sometimes helps, even if you're sure you have fairly recent ones. In any case, trying that first is much faster than figuring out the problem step-by-step later, so it's worth the time spent. And, again, it won't hurt to have up-to-date drivers anyway.
I won't post a link here, because it depends on your videocard. I'm sure you know where to get them from, usually it's NVIDIA or AMD website.

4) Try deleing prefs.cs file from your Documens/My Games/Age of Decadence folder, if it exists there.

It may remain there from an old AoD version and have incorrect settings.

5) Try compatibility mode. Right-click AoD.exe in the game folder, select Properties. In Properties window, go to Compatibility tab and set the next settings:

[v] Run this program in compatibility mode for:
Windows 7

[v] Run this program as an administrator

6) Uninstall and reinstall the game.
Additionally, before reinstalling, go to your Steam library folder and delete the "Age of Decadence" folder manually, so no traces of it are left. After that, go to your Documents/My Games/ folder, and if you don't have any saves, delete "Age of Decadence" from there too. If you have, temporarily move them (*.sav files) to a different folder, then delete "Age of Decadence". You can move back your saves later, when the game starts for you.

It helped a lot of people. Be it just corrupted files or junk from previous versions that wasn't cleaned up by Steam for some reason, having a clean installation is always a good thing in a case like this.

7) Opt out of Steam client beta, if you're participating in one.

8) Post the contents of your console.log file to this thread. It may help us figuring out what kind of error do you get, or at what stage of loading does the game stop working.

The file's location is your Documens/My Games/Age of Decadence/console.log

9) Finally, if nothing from above helps, feel free to describe your issue here. If it crashes for you and suggests to send a crash report to us, please do so, but also state your email or Steam username in that window, so when you post here about your problem, we could find your crash report among others.
Then I'll examine the crash dump personally and will try to figure out what's going wrong there from code point of view.

Flashback  [developer] Sep 21, 2015 @ 11:25am 
Originally posted by Clown Reemus:
Did anyone encounter an issue with madly moving mouse? My wireless mouse is going in the direction I last move it. Makes it unconfortable to play.

This is kinda offtopic for this thread, but try opening a console window ( ~ button ), typing "lockMouse(0);" (without quotes) and press enter. It should enable hardware cursor and maybe solve your issue.

Flashback  [developer] Oct 14, 2015 @ 7:54am 
Are you trying to launch it windowed or full screen? Because in windowed mode, the resolution *has* to be smaller than your desktop resolution. If it's equal or larger, the engine will reduce it to fit the desktop.
